The leaflets, in Arabic, read: "Nato will use all possible means to destroy all armour used against civilians. Stop fighting. When you see these helicopters, it means it is already too late for you."
The clinic is quiet right now. On Friday more than 30 dead fighters and almost 200 wounded were brought to the young doctors here. Almost all the victims these days are from rocket, artillery and mortar fire.

For the US, the blame lies very much with its European allies. Mr Gates has singled out Germany, Poland, Spain, Netherlands and Portugal for having the means to contribute to the Libya operation but refusing to do so. There is particular anguish over the stance taken by Germany and Poland, given that they have a combined 400 combat jets at their disposal
